SDH Institute’s Post Graduate Diploma Programmes are for individuals who want to acquire the specialised knowledge and qualifications required to explore and enter into a  different industry, or for existing professionals who aspire to career progression.

Students will learn from a network of  established industry practitioners; this will enable them to have an  extra edge in securing fruitful employment and build their careers upon  graduation. Students will gain a solid understanding of the business and  management aspects of the industry from the course major selected.

English Language Requirement

Attainment of IELTS 6.0 or equivalent OR pass the internal assessment

Normal Entry:

Obtained a Bachelor Degree in any field or equivalent

Alternative Entry:

Applicants with the minimum age of 30, who do not possess the above qualifications but have a minimum of 8 years of working experience, may be considered for entry into this course. Evidence of previous  employment will need to be provided as well as a reference from the  current/most recent employer (on letter-headed paper)

Human Capital Management

 The module is designed to equip learners with the abilities and skills to adapt and manage an increasingly diverse human resource, and in a competitive business environment. The areas include diversity management; job analysis and job design; human resource planning; and recruiting, screening and selection of candidates; interviewing candidates; orientation, training and development; compensation, incentives and benefits; evaluating and appraising employee performance; and organizational culture and cross-cultural issues.

Business Research and Planing

This module is designed to formulate a business plan simulated closest  to actual pitching for venture capital. It covers the rudiments of  research designs with the needed methods and tools for data gathering  useful to strengthen contentions pointing to certain business goals  included in the plan. It also includes financial and quantitative  techniques surveys, negotiating for funding, intellectual property, and  business operations.
